XML 145 R123.htm IDEA: XBRL DOCUMENT v3.3.1.900
Stock Based Compensation Plans (Employee Stock Purchase Plan - Summary) (Details) - $ / shares
12 Months Ended
Dec. 31, 2015
Dec. 31, 2014
Dec. 31, 2013
Employee Stock Ownership Plan (ESOP) Disclosures [Line Items]      
Employee Stock Purchase Plan - Shares Issued 168,962 157,856 167,260
Minimum [Member]      
Employee Stock Ownership Plan (ESOP) Disclosures [Line Items]      
Employee Stock Purchase Plan - Purchase Price Per Share $ 90.87 $ 84.6 $ 69.27
Maximum [Member]      
Employee Stock Ownership Plan (ESOP) Disclosures [Line Items]      
Employee Stock Purchase Plan - Purchase Price Per Share $ 90.55 $ 86.67 $ 73.7